Understanding Auto Injuries and Their Hidden Nature
Auto injuries are uniquely complex because they often don't manifest immediately after an accident. The adrenaline rush and shock of a collision can mask pain and discomfort for hours or even days. This delayed onset is one of the most critical factors to consider when deciding if specialized treatment is right for you.
Many people in Hubbard and surrounding areas like Canfield make the mistake of assuming they're fine simply because they don't feel pain immediately after an accident. However, the biomechanics of vehicle collisions create forces that can cause soft tissue damage, joint misalignments, and muscular trauma that may not become apparent until inflammation sets in.
Whiplash, for instance, affects millions of Americans annually and is one of the most common auto injuries. The rapid back-and-forth motion of the head and neck during impact can strain muscles, ligaments, and vertebrae in ways that traditional medical approaches sometimes overlook. Consider whether you're experiencing any of these symptoms: neck stiffness, headaches, shoulder pain, dizziness, or difficulty concentrating. These could indicate underlying injuries that benefit from specialized treatment approaches.

Insurance coverage is another critical factor that many Hubbard residents need to evaluate carefully. Auto insurance policies often include personal injury protection (PIP) coverage that can help pay for treatment costs. However, the specifics of your coverage, including deductibles, copayments, and approved treatment types, will influence your decision. It's worth reviewing your policy details or speaking with your insurance provider to understand what options are available to you.
Consider also the potential long-term costs of not seeking appropriate treatment. While immediate out-of-pocket expenses might seem daunting, chronic pain conditions that develop from untreated auto injuries can result in much higher healthcare costs over time, not to mention lost productivity and diminished quality of life.
The timing of your decision matters too. Most insurance policies have specific timeframes for reporting injuries and beginning treatment after an accident. In Ohio, these windows can be relatively short, so prompt evaluation and decision-making are important to preserve your options.
